
Lots of healthy fats and antioxidant ingredients in these yummy cookies! They’re soft, cake-y, and they’re great with a glass of milk as a recovery food or pre-run, pre-ride breakfast. The ginger, cloves and honey give them a bit of a lebkuchen taste!
1/3 cup canola or olive oil
1/2 cup honey
1/2 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
1 teaspoon ground ginger
1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
3/4 teaspoon salt
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
1 large egg
2 tablespoons maple syrup
1 cup shredded raw sweet potato
1/2 cup dried cranberries or blueberries
1/2 cup bittersweet chocolate chips
1/2 cup chopped raw almonds
1 cup whole wheat flour
1 1/2 cups quick rolled oats
Mix everything except the flour, soda, and baking powder in a large bowl. Mix the three remaining dry ingredients together in a separate bowl. Add the wet and dry mixtures together, stirring until just moistened.
Using a tablespoon, drop large balls of dough on a greased cookie sheet. You can crowd them fairly close because they don’t spread out too much. Bake at 350F for about 12 minutes. Don’t over-bake them or they’ll get dried out.
Yield: about 25 large cookies.
